Boom
27. Use the hoist to remove the outer boom from the
frame. Position the outer boom on a hard, flat
surface. Block the boom as required to allow
removal of the extend/retract cylinder from the
underside of the boom.
28. Use a hoist and slings to support the extend/retract
cylinder. At the base end of the cylinder, remove a
retaining ring (Fig. 3-44, 1) from one side of the
cylinder base end pin (2). Use a brass punch and a
rawhide hammer to remove the base end pin from
the mounting ears on the outer boom.
29. Inspect the pin (Fig. 3-44, 2) for damage. If the pin is
damaged, it should be replaced. Retain the retaining
rings for reassembly.
Figure 3- 44 Extend/Retract Cylinder Base End Pin
30. Lower the base end of the extend/retract cylinder
and remove the rod end of the cylinder from the
retainer at the front of the boom. Place the extend/
retract cylinder on a clean, flat surface.
31. At the front of the outer boom, remove the elastic
locknut (Fig. 3-45, 1) holding the rubber bumper (2)
to the extend/retract cylinder retainer (3). Discard the
elastic locknut.
32. Inspect the rubber bumper (Fig. 3-45, 2). If it is in
good condition, the rubber bumper can be reused. If
the rubber bumper is showing signs of cracking or
deterioration, it should be replaced.
Figure 3-45 Rubber Bumper
33. Inspect the bearings (Fig. 3-46, 1). If the bearing
rotates freely inside the outer race, the bearing can
be left in place. If the bearing is damaged it must be
replaced
34. Remove the self-aligning bearings (Fig. 3-46, 1)
from the lift/lower cylinder mounts (2) and the slave
cylinder mounts (3).
